Improving Time Off Request Process with an OpenAir Script
In the dynamic realm of project management, ensuring smooth time-off approval processes can pose a significant challenge. Top Step recently encountered this situation faced by one of their valued customers. The challenge centered around the efficient routing of time-off requests for employees engaged in long-term client projects spanning 6-12 months. In response, Top Step leveraged the power of OpenAir Scripting to improve and remove the conflicts in their customer’s time-off approval workflow.
The Challenge
The crux of the issue stemmed from the customer’s existing time-off approval process. Typically, employees submit their requests to their direct managers. However, in this specific customer’s scenario, where employees were frequently immersed in client projects with extended durations, this conventional approach proved inadequate. The challenge lay in empowering project managers, who have the in-depth insights into employee availability, to make well-informed decisions regarding time off. However, OpenAir’s default configuration did not support the dynamic routing of time-off requests to project managers.
The Solution
Top Step harnessed the power of OpenAir Scripting to craft a tailor-made solution that would streamline time-off approvals and notifications, ultimately benefiting the employees, project managers, and the direct manager.
How the Script Works
The OpenAir Script, designed to address this customer’s challenge, operates as follows:
Request Submission: When an employee submits a time-off request, the OpenAir Script springs into action. It automatically checks the person’s bookings for the requested time period.
Project Identification: The script then identifies which project or projects the employee is currently assigned to during the requested time off.
Dynamic Routing: Departing from the conventional route, the script intelligently reroutes the request. Instead of forwarding it to the employee’s direct manager, it channels it directly to the project manager(s) associated with the pertinent project(s).
Handling Multiple Projects: To address scenarios where the employee is engaged in multiple projects during the same week, the script goes the extra mile. It calculates which project has the most hours booked and sends the request to the project manager of that specific project. In cases where hours are evenly split, the script ensures the request is routed to all relevant project managers.
Notifications: Beyond approvals, the script can double up as a robust notification system. It can proactively inform project managers when a team member is scheduled to be on leave. This added visibility equips project managers with critical resource availability insights without necessitating formal approval authority.
The End Result
This relatively straightforward yet impactful OpenAir Script has brought about a significant enhancement to Top Step’s customer’s time-off approval and resource planning processes. Time-off approvals and notifications now lie in the capable hands of those best positioned to gauge their impact – the project managers. This transformation frees direct managers from having to make decisions concerning employees who are not under their immediate purview during the time-off period.
This OpenAir Script example serves as an exemplary case of how scripts can efficiently address nuanced workflow challenges within the OpenAir platform. With OpenAir Scripts, the possibilities are indeed boundless, enabling organizations to tailor solutions to their unique business needs.